> LeanPath Announces Royal Caribbean International Launch of
> ValuWaste(R) Food Waste Reduction Process
> Leading Cruise Line Aims to Reduce Food Waste in Galleys of World's
> Largest Cruise Ship
>
> PORTLAND, Ore. & MIAMI
> LeanPath, Inc. (www.leanpath.com) today announced the implementation
> of the ValuWaste® food waste reduction solution with Royal Caribbean
> International (www.royalcaribbean.com). Royal Caribbean recently
> launched the ValuWaste program aboard Freedom of the Seas, the largest
> and most innovative cruise ship in the world. LeanPath, founded in
> 2004, is a consulting and technology development company that delivers
> products and services to the hospitality and food service industries
> to reduce food costs and impact sustainability initiatives.
>
> For the first time, the cruise line will measure all pre-consumer food
> waste generated during production of as many as 18,000 meals per day.
> ValuWaste has been installed in galleys and production areas on five
> decks of the ship. Crew members will use ValuWaste tracking equipment
> to record data on diverse meal types, including formal dinners and
> buffet service. Royal Caribbean will use the information from data
> processed by the ValuWaste software to optimize production practices
> and reduce food waste. The cruise line implemented the ValuWaste
> solution to drive efficiency and further contribute to sustainability
> in the ship's culinary operations.

> About Royal Caribbean International
>
> Royal Caribbean International is a global cruise brand with 20 ships
> currently in service and three under construction. Liberty of the
> Seas, the cruise line's newest ship, which debuts in May 2007, will
> share the title of largest cruise ship at sea with sister-ship Freedom
> of the Seas. At 160,000 GRT with a capacity of 3,634 guests in
> double-occupancy, Liberty of the Seas will offer alternating Eastern
> and Western Caribbean itineraries from Miami. The line also offers
> unique land-tour vacations in Alaska, Canada, Europe, Australia and
